Thursday, May 5, 2022 - This was an interesting Burgundy filled with contrast! It was both smooth and acidic at the same time...a unique experience for me. This was, IMO, a much more intellectual wine that you enjoyed while trying to piece together the puzzle.

Nose: Lemon, seashell and stone fruit dominated with hints of white flower and flint

Palate: Showed a contrast of smoothness and acidity that is hard to accurately describe. Pear, tart apple, oyster shell and flint, but then turning to tropical fruit and citrus, with quite a bit of minerality.

This wine was a delight to drink, and really was a unique experience, although the 2016 Roulot alongside was more in my wheelhouse as far as flavor profile. 92 points for uniqueness and pleasure!
